Some countries officially recognize Bitcoin:
Japan officially recognizes bitcoin and digital currencies as a "means of payment that is not a legal currency"
Others declared it "not illegal":
As of November 2016 declared, bitcoins are "not illegal" according to the Federal Tax Service of Russia
